Sorry. The current release process of APT/Yum repositories
doesn't allow multiple releases in parallel. In this case,
the following timeline isn't allowed:

1. Prepare ADBC 12 RC3
2. Prepare Arrow 16.1.0 RC1
3. Release ADBC 12
4. Release Arrow 16.1.0

We have only one APT/Yum repositories for RC. So APT/Yum
repositories for 1. was overwritten by APT/Yum repositories
for 2.

Can we use the following timeline?

1. Prepare Arrow 16.1.0 RC1
2. Release Arrow 16.1.0
3. Prepare ADBC 12 RC3
4. Release ADBC 12

Or:

1. Prepare ADBC 12 RC3
2. Release ADBC 12
3. Prepare Arrow 16.1.0 RC1
4. Release Arrow 16.1.0

> Please note that the versioning scheme has changed.  This is the 12th release 
> of ADBC, and so is called version "12".  The subcomponents, however, are 
> versioned independently:
> 
> - C/C++/GLib/Go/Python/Ruby: 1.0.0
> - C#: 0.12.0
> - Java: 0.12.0
> - R: 0.12.0
> - Rust: 0.12.0
> 
> These are the versions you will see in the source and in actual packages.  
> The next release will be "13", and the subcomponents will increment their 
> versions independently (to either 1.1.0, 0.13.0, or 1.0.0).  At this point, 
> there is no plan to release subcomponents independently from the project as a 
> whole.
